Blockchain technology has the potential to revolutionize the way mobile apps are secured and protect user data. The decentralized and distributed feature of blockchain gives multiple advantages for improving mobile app security.
It is used for securing identity verification, allowing for secure and seamless transactions within mobile apps. Especially, a fintech app development company highly uses blockchain in their fintech solutions to strengthen payment security with cryptographic encryption.
In addition to this, there are many ways blockchain technology is helping to improve mobile app security. And this article, we will discuss this.
What Is Blockchain Technology?
A blockchain is a digital, decentralized ledger technology. It records transactions across a network of blocks or nodes, which together forms a blockchain. It allows multiple parties to have access to the same information, and once a block of data is recorded on the blockchain, it cannot be altered. This makes it a secure and transparent way to store and transfer information, and it is the technology that powers cryptocurrencies like Bitcoin.
How Blockchain Technology Improves Mobile App Security?
Blockchain technology plays a significant role in improving mobile app security. Developers use blockchain in mobile app development to enhance the security of data, user identity, and transactions within the app. This is due to the benefits that blockchain offers for enhancing security standards in mobile apps.
- Decentralization: Blockchain technology is a decentralized system that allows for secure and transparent transactions. This eliminates the need for a central authority, reducing the risk of a single point of failure. With decentralized data storage, mobile apps can safely store data.
- Immutable Ledgers: Blockchain technology uses a distributed ledger system that cannot be altered or tampered with. This ensures that all transactions are recorded and stored in an immutable and secure manner.
- Data Encryption: Blockchain technology uses advanced encryption methods to protect data with cryptography encryption techniques. This makes a system almost impossible for hackers to access or tamper with sensitive information. It is used for protecting data from unauthorized access during transactions or data processing.
- Smart Contracts: Blockchain technology enables developers to use the features of smart contracts in mobile app development. Smart contracts are
self-executing contracts with the terms of the agreement between buyer and seller being directly written into lines of code. This eliminates the need for intermediaries and reduces the risk of fraud.
- Multi-Signature Authentication: Blockchain technology allows for multi-signature authentication, where multiple parties must approve a transaction before it can be executed. This adds an additional layer of security and reduces the risk of unauthorized transactions. Therefore, this technique is used in many fintech app development services for securing in-app payments.
- Traceability: Blockchain technology allows for the traceability of all transactions, making it easy to track the origin of any data or funds and identify any suspicious activity. This helps prevent fraud and other security breaches.
- Auditability: Blockchain technology provides a tamper-proof and transparent record of all transactions, making it easy to track and audit any suspicious activity. This empowers end-users or stakeholders with full control over the transactions happening through smart contracts or any other application.
- Identity Verification: Blockchain technology helps in verifying the identity of users and ensures that only verified users get access to critical information. It enables mobile apps to ensure that only verified users get access to the app. Developers use blockchain in creating high-end biometric login processes in mobile apps for enhanced user identity verification standards.
Future Of Blockchain In Mobile App Development
The future of blockchain in mobile app development is promising as it offers a number of benefits to both developers and users. As more developers are increasingly adopting blockchain technology, the future scope of blockchain in mobile app development is set to rise significantly. And this is because of the features of blockchain which empowers app development in the following ways:
Security: Blockchain technology is highly secure and allows for secure data storage and transactions. This makes it a great option for mobile apps that handle sensitive information such as personal data or financial transactions.
Decentralization: Blockchain technology is decentralized. It means it doesn’t involve any single entity. This makes it more resilient to attacks and makes sure data is fully secured and accessible to the parties.
Transparency: It offers better transparency and makes the transactions visible to everyone on the network. Since every involved party has access to track the transactions happening in real-time, it eliminates the risks of discrepancy.
Smart Contracts: Blockchain technology allows for the use of smart contracts, which are self-executing contracts that can be used to automate processes and ensure that terms are met. This can be a useful feature in mobile apps that require contract management.
Tokenization: Blockchain technology allows for the creation of digital tokens that can be used to represent assets, such as virtual goods or services. This can be a useful feature in mobile apps that require in-app purchases or rewards systems.
Blockchain technology has the potential to revolutionize mobile app development by offering secure and decentralized solutions. It empowers developers to create new types of apps equipped with high-end features.
However, blockchain technology is still relatively new and its full potential in mobile app development has yet to be fully realized. In the future, we can expect to see more experimentation and innovation in this area as developers and companies explore the possibilities of blockchain in mobile app development.
To Wrap Up
Overall, the decentralized and secure nature of blockchain technology can help to improve mobile app security by providing a secure platform for data storage and transactions and by protecting against hacking attempts and data breaches.
As the adoption of blockchain technology continues to grow, it is likely that we will see more and more mobile apps leveraging this technology to provide enhanced security and privacy features to users.
Thus, if you want to effectively utilize the blockchain to enhance the security of your app, you should take assistance from a professional mobile app development company that specializes in implementing blockchain technology in mobile apps.
About The Author
Aditya Sehgal is a blockchain developer at MobileCoderz-a industry’s leading web and mobile app development company that provides state-of-the-art digital solutions for multiple industries. She holds more than 4 years of experience in blockchain development including smart contracts and Ethereum development. She is specialized in implementing blockchain technology for web and mobile app solutions. Besides this, She shares her expert options on leading tech sites and platforms.